thermoplastic Capable of softening when heated to change shape and hardening when cooled to keep shape.

thermoplastic A material which will soften, flow or distort appreciably when subjected to sufficient heat & pressure.

thermoplastic (1) adjective Becoming soft when heated and hard when cooled. (2)noun A thermoplastic resin, such as polystyrene or polyethylene.

thermoplastic a polymer that melts or flows when heated.

thermoplastic a polymer which may be softened by heat and hardened by cooling in a reversible physical process.
